Underwear Queen Michelle Mone gives her ex-husband a deadline of tomorrow to buy her out of their lingerie empire
By Katy Winter
|
Entrepreneur: Michelle started her career as a model before founding Ultimo. She is now thought to be worth £39 million
Bra tycoon Michelle Mone has given her ex-husband until tomorrow to buy control of their multi-million pound lingerie business.
Ms Mone split from husband Michael last Christmas over his relationship with Ultimo designer Samantha Bunn, 31.
She confirmed earlier this week that she has offered to buy Mr Mone out of the £50m business and given him until tomorrow to consider it.
Ms Mone, who is battling for control of her business, revealed on Monday on Twitter that she had made an offer.
'I’m hoping my ex will accept offer for me to buy him of the business I started,' she tweeted.
The lingerie queen has insisted that she can never work with Mr Mone, 45, again and says their firm has to be controlled by one or the other.
And Ms Mone later added: 'I have made him an offer to buy him out which he has until Friday to consider.'
The businesswoman recently told a trade magazine: 'I’m changing a lot of plans at the moment. My husband went away with my designer - [it all depends on] who is going to be taking over the business, either him or me.
'Ultimo is my baby. I am still exceptionally passionate about it, so we will see what happens. I hope to take over it.
'But I will certainly not be working with him much longer. If I take over, I have got big plans for it.'
Ultimo is rumoured to have a 42 million pound turnover and has subsidiaries like Ultimo Swimwear, Miss Ultimo, Adore Moi and ‘Diamond Boutique’.
It recently celebrated its 13th birthday and launched a range inspired by the 'mummy porn' novel Fifty Shades of Grey.
Ms Mone, 41, is estimated to be worth £39 million pounds, according to Celebrity Networth.
But Ms Mone holds 142 shares in parent firm MJM International while her estranged husband has one more with 143.

She founded MJM International Ltd in November 1996, and three years of research, design, and development resulted in the patented Ultimo bra. In August 1999, a month after having her third child, Michelle launched Ultimo at Selfridges department store in London. Selfridges sold the pre-launch estimate of six weeks of stock within 24 hours.
She grew up in relative poverty in Glasgow before finding work as a model.
After running a sales and marketing team for the Labatt’s brewing company, she made the decision to create a range of support bras after the idea came to her while wearing an uncomfortable bra during a dinner party.
Ms Mone recently amicably split from her new man after just four months.
Ultimo's new range is inspired my the Fifty Shades of Grey phenomenon and looks set to enhance the brands already huge estimated £42 million turnover
She started dating handsome financier Karl French earlier this year following her stormy break-up from husband Michael.
But Ms Mone claimed they struggled to see each other because Mr French lives in Dubai.
Mother-of-three Ms Mone fell for ex-boyfriend Mr French as she holidayed with her kids in Dubai in April while trying to put her split with hubby Michael behind her.
The bra queen later described Mr French as her 'rock' after he helped her get through a cancer ordeal.
She had an operation in May to remove a cancerous mole with Mr French by her side.
